Big Fish Games

www.bigfishgames.com

 
Since its founding in 2002, Big Fish has been the world`s largest producer and distributor of casual games, with titles which continuously land us at the top of app store charts. Today, we`re bounding into the mid-core space, exploring new and exciting forms of gameplay, and producing more fun than ever! Big Fish is home to six individual studios, each with its own unique style of game-play. Together, we`re united under a common goal: to produce and develop the very best in mobile gaming, and bring fun and entertainment to our millions of customers around the globe!
